Abstract

This paper includes studying the microfacies evalution of Mauddud Formaion infour wells(Rt-2, Rt-5, Rt17 and Rt-19). Seventy-seven(77) sampels were collectedof above mentioned wells. Based on fossil content of the samples under study, fourmain microfacies were identified: packstone , wakestone , grainstone and limemudstone microfacies ,which deposited in shallow open marine and restrictedmarine environments. Petrographic examination of thin section indicated thatdiagenesis vary in intensity from one site to another, such as dissolution,cementation, compaction, dolomitization and micritization, which led to theimprovement and deterioration of porosity. The dominant pore types are vuggy,interparticle and intercrystal.The lithology, mineralogy and the matrix weredetermined by using crossplot method, which showed that the predominantlithology of the formation is limestone with the presence of dolomite in very fewpercentages and the mineralogy is calcite. Based on the relationship betweenporosity and permeability the resevoir performance of the microfacies classifiedinto four types: bad, fair, good and very good. Based on petrophysical propertiesand core description of well study Mauddud Formation was divided into four rockunits A,B,C and D , in terms of reservoir, units A and C are considered good ,whileB and D are bad.
